Response Time Metrics and Their Impact on Player Satisfaction

One of the most immediate indicators of support quality is the response time. Fast responses demonstrate that the casino values players’ time and are committed to resolving issues promptly. Research from industry benchmarks indicates that leading platforms aim for initial response times within 30 seconds to 2 minutes for live chat, under an hour for email, and immediate handling for urgent phone calls.

For example, Betway, a prominent online casino, reports an average live chat response time of approximately 45 seconds, which significantly contributes to higher player satisfaction scores. According to the Casino Support Satisfaction Index 2023, casinos with faster response times tend to have lower churn rates and higher player loyalty, emphasizing that quick assistance directly influences retention.

Resolution Rates and Follow-Up Procedures in High-Profile Casinos

Resolution rate—the percentage of support cases conclusively closed—serves as a fundamental quality metric. High-resolution rates, often above 90%, indicate effective problem-solving capabilities.

Leading casinos implement rigorous follow-up procedures to ensure issues are fully resolved. For instance, after resolving a withdrawal dispute, a support team member might follow up via email or phone to confirm satisfaction. This proactive approach not only resolves immediate issues but also builds trust.

Case studies show that casinos like 888 Casino maintain detailed logs and employ escalation protocols for complex disputes, ensuring sustained support quality. As a result, players experiencing prompt, thorough resolutions tend to develop greater brand loyalty and are more likely to recommend the casino to others.

Availability and Multilingual Support Options for Global Players

Since the online casino industry is truly global, support teams must cater to diverse linguistic backgrounds. Top operators provide multilingual support, often covering major languages such as English, German, Spanish, Chinese, and Russian.

A study by the European Gaming Authority suggests that players are more likely to engage with platforms that offer support in their native language, which enhances trust and reduces misunderstandings. For instance, LeoVegas supports over 10 languages, demonstrating awareness of market diversity.

Moreover, multilingual chat and email support, coupled with culturally aware customer service representatives, significantly improve communication clarity and satisfaction levels among international players.

Supporting multiple languages also involves localized resources like FAQs and tutorials, which can mitigate support load and empower players to resolve common issues independently.

Live Chat Versus Email and Phone Support: Which Delivers Faster Results?

Support channels vary in response time and effectiveness. Live chat is typically the fastest method, providing near-instant engagement. For example, data from CasinoSupportPro reveals that live chat agents address player inquiries within 1 to 2 minutes on average, making it highly suitable for resolving urgent issues.

In contrast, email support, while comprehensive and detailed, averages several hours to a full day for responses, which may hinder player satisfaction in time-sensitive situations. Phone support, when available, offers real-time resolution but can be limited by staffing constraints.

Many clientele prefer a hybrid model: instant chat for minor issues, complemented by email support for complex cases requiring detailed responses. The key is maintaining operational efficiency across channels to meet player expectations consistently.

Utilizing Self-Help Portals and FAQ Sections to Reduce Support Load

Effective self-help resources are fundamental in modern support strategies. Casinos like JackpotCity have invested heavily in comprehensive FAQs, tutorial videos, and knowledge bases that empower players to troubleshoot common issues independently.

Studies indicate that up to 60% of support inquiries can be handled through well-designed self-help portals, reducing support team workload and speeding up resolution times for routine questions. This not only improves operational efficiency but also enhances user experience by providing instant solutions.

Practices include regularly updating FAQs based on player questions, incorporating search functionalities, and integrating interactive guides to address issues like account verification or deposit procedures.

Integration of AI and Chatbots in Customer Service Workflows

The advent of AI-powered chatbots has revolutionized online casino support. These bots handle frequently asked questions, process basic transactions, and even route complex issues to human agents. Casinos like Betfair have reported that their chatbot solutions handle approximately 70% of support queries without human intervention, significantly decreasing response times and operational costs.

Further, AI can analyze player history and preferences to offer personalized assistance, which enhances the overall experience. While chatbots are not yet fully capable of replacing human empathy, their strategic deployment allows support teams to focus on complex, high-value cases.

Important considerations include ongoing training of AI systems, data security, and ensuring a seamless handover to human agents when necessary.

Training Standards and Certification Requirements for Support Agents

High-quality support begins with well-trained staff. Leading online casinos enforce rigorous onboarding programs, often requiring certifications such as IATA, HCII, or GDPR compliance training. For example, bet365 trains its agents in legal compliance, responsible gaming, and technical troubleshooting, ensuring consistent support standards.

Ongoing training, including role-playing scenarios and regular assessments, sustains skill levels and keeps staff updated on policy changes. Certification requirements not only validate expertise but also enhance player confidence in support interactions.

Empathy and Personalization in Handling Player Concerns

Effective customer support requires emotional intelligence. Personalized interactions, where agents demonstrate empathy and understanding, lead to higher satisfaction. For instance, in dispute cases involving account suspensions, support staff trained in empathy practices can de-escalate tension and reach amicable solutions.

Supporting tools like CRM systems track player history, enabling agents to personalize responses and offer tailored solutions rather than generic replies. Such practices foster trust and reinforce brand loyalty.

Research shows that players who experience empathetic support are twice as likely to remain loyal compared to those receiving impersonal service.

Correlation Between Support Quality and Player Churn Rates

Data from industry studies reveal that players are less likely to leave casinos that offer consistent, high-quality support. Casinos with an average resolution time below 1 hour and resolution rates exceeding 90% retain a higher percentage of their players over time. According to the 2023 Global Casino Loyalty Report, exceptional support reduces churn by up to 25% compared to competitors with average support standards.

Support quality acts as a primary touchpoint for players, greatly influencing their overall perception of the casino’s reliability and professionalism.

Feedback Loops: Using Player Input to Improve Service Delivery

Most leading casinos actively solicit player feedback through surveys, review prompts, and post-support follow-up calls. This input feeds into continuous improvement processes, leading to refined support protocols, better training, and upgraded tools.

For example, Caesars Casino collects real-time feedback on chat interactions, enabling support managers to identify common issues and adjust training modules accordingly. This iterative cycle fosters a culture of constant enhancement, directly benefiting player satisfaction and loyalty.
